mediatomb(DLNAサーバー)のインストールでmysqlエラー(解決)

の記事を参考にDLNAサーバーの導入を行おうとしていましたが、どうもサービスが起動せず、Webブラウザからmediatombの画面を拝むことができなかったので、その解決法をメモしておきます。

ログを見てみる(cat /var/log/mediatomb)

2011-09-10 17:27:57 ERROR: The connection to the MySQL database has failed:

mysql_error (2002): “Can’t connect to local MySQL server through socket ‘/var/lib/mysql/mysql.sock’ (2)”

どうやら mysql とのソケット通信用のファイルパスが決め打ちであったため、正しく起動していなかったようです。

vi /etc/mediatomb/config.xml にて

<socket>/mnt/your_setting/mysql.sock</socket>

</mysql>

と <mysql> タグ内に <socket> 設定を自分の環境にあわせることで正しくサービスが動作することを確認できました。

シェアする

  • このエントリーをはてなブックマークに追加

フォローする